“Death comes in many forms—sometimes peaceful, sometimes tragic, sometimes dramatic . . . and at other times just plain weird. In History’s Weirdest Deaths (Portable Press, ISBN: 978-1684127573, Hardcover $12.99, 128 pages), you’ll read the true stories of more than a hundred people who met their end in a bizarre fashion. Each cautionary tale is unique. Meet the victims of stunts that went horribly wrong, ordinary people who made boneheaded blunders, and famous figures who realized too late that celebrity isn’t a cure for stupidity. “

Alejandra shared, "We’ve been doing Hispanic plays in translation since 2016. The micro theater Festival idea occurred to me because it is a format very popular and successful in Spain and Latin America. Since it was during the summer we wanted to do something fun and fresh, so we added live music, food and drinks and we were really surprised with the response we got. People really enjoy the whole event and we hope to do it every summer. We will continue doing a play during the fall and spring. On November 9-10, 15-16 we’ll be presenting our next play “Idiots Contemplating the Snow”, by Alejandro Ricaño at the Monticello Opera House.

They say that musica is the universal language, and Babushka definitivamente agrees with that. So, time to share the history of one of the most beloved and shared songs of all time- Auld Lang Syne. For the full rendition go to Scotland.org for a lovely share.

"In 1788 Robert Burns sent the poem ‘Auld Lang Syne’ to the Scots Musical Museum, indicating that it was an ancient song but that he’d been the first to record it on paper. The phrase ‘auld lang syne’ roughly translates as ‘for old times’ sake’, and the song is all about preserving old friendships and looking back over the events of the year.

It is sung all over the world, evoking a sense of belonging and fellowship, tinged with nostalgia.

It has long been a much-loved Scottish tradition to sing the song just before midnight. Everyone stands in a circle holding hands, then at the beginning of the final verse (‘And there’s a hand my trusty friend…’) they cross their arms across their bodies so that their left hand is holding the hand of the person on their right, and their right hand holds that of the person on their left. When the song ends, everyone rushes to the middle, still holding hands, and probably giggling.
